Frank Tuchfarber 19th Century Chromolithograph of a Young Boy

Item Details

An 1896 antique chromolithograph on paper mounted on cardboard by Belgian artist Frank Tuchfarber. The portrait depicts a young boy in knickers, suspenders, a red vest, and a flat dark hat. Flowing yellow curls fall across his face, and he stands against an empty beige background. The piece’s date, artist’s name, and publishing location (Cincinnati, where he famously created many of his most popular chromolithographs) are all printed in fine lettering in the lower right corner. The print is presented in a vintage wormy chestnut frame with a wire attached to the verso for hanging. More information about the artist can be found under Related Links.
